From b41b6d58e0faccc53073403eb7ef063dfc08e053 Mon Sep 17 00:00:00 2001 From: Evan Debenham Date: Sun, 13 Sep 2020 01:15:40 -0400 Subject: [PATCH] v0.9.0: fixed ring of might health bonus not being affected by degrade --- .../shatteredpixeldungeon/actors/buffs/Degrade.java | 3 +++ 1 file changed, 3 insertions(+) diff --git a/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/actors/buffs/Degrade.java b/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/actors/buffs/Degrade.java index 010d9a6a4..9b232013d 100644 --- a/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/actors/buffs/Degrade.java +++ b/core/src/main/java/com/shatteredpixel/shatteredpixeldungeon/actors/buffs/Degrade.java @@ -22,6 +22,7 @@ package com.shatteredpixel.shatteredpixeldungeon.actors.buffs; import com.shatteredpixel.shatteredpixeldungeon.actors.Char; +import com.shatteredpixel.shatteredpixeldungeon.actors.hero.Hero; import com.shatteredpixel.shatteredpixeldungeon.items.Item; import com.shatteredpixel.shatteredpixeldungeon.messages.Messages; import com.shatteredpixel.shatteredpixeldungeon.ui.BuffIndicator; @@ -39,6 +40,7 @@ public class Degrade extends FlavourBuff { public boolean attachTo(Char target) { if (super.attachTo(target)){ Item.updateQuickslot(); + if (target instanceof Hero) ((Hero) target).updateHT(false); return true; } return false; @@ -47,6 +49,7 @@ public class Degrade extends FlavourBuff { @Override public void detach() { super.detach(); + if (target instanceof Hero) ((Hero) target).updateHT(false); Item.updateQuickslot(); }